Ohio Army National Guard Staff Sgt. Kelly Ann Pels, of Headquarters and Headquarters Battery, 1st Battalion, 174th Air Defense Artillery Regiment and a Cincinnati, Ohio, resident, meets U.S. Defense Secretary Leon Panetta July 11, 2011, during a town hall meeting with troops stationed at Camp Victory in Baghdad, Iraq. Pels was also one of six deployed service members, representing each of the military service branches, Panetta called on Independence Day to thank for their service. (U.S. Army photo by Staff Sgt. April Davis)
